A particle reaches its highest point when it has covered exactly one half of its horizontal range. The corresponding point on the displacement -time graph is charecterized by :

A

negative slope and zero curvature

B

zero slope and negative curvature

C

zero slope and positive curvature

D

positive slope and zero curvature

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

At the highest point, the slope is zero and curvature is positive
